Sorry we haven’t fixed this yet. Let’s at least find out whether or not /textpattern/index.php is involved. Rename the file index.4.3.0.php and then add that to the URL (mysite/textpattern/index.4.3.0.php). (If this is a client site, make a copy of the file so there’s still an index.php for the client to use.) Then go to advanced prefs. Is the error still there?
